Output 8605ec312efda3db86c44590432eca38a91fd44fb91f12d334132613cbc04a39:1
- value
- 183650710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9d354a5e47b7a4635be68f05d0268c5ba0ea7c9 OP_EQUAL
- address
- 3L6AucWgZuEULHcbfJg5HbnBbywqbmSHjh
- transaction
- 8605ec312efda3db86c44590432eca38a91fd44fb91f12d334132613cbc04a39
- confirmations
- 373102
- spent
- true